From the Guidelines

CPT code 90832 represents a psychotherapy session, and according to the most recent evidence, it is one of the codes that can be used with a telemedicine modifier ("95") to indicate that services were provided using telemedicine technology. This code is used by mental health professionals, including psychiatrists, psychologists, and licensed therapists, when billing for individual psychotherapy services 1. The session typically involves therapeutic communication and activities designed to address mental health conditions or psychological issues. Some key points to consider when using this code include:

  • The provider must use an interactive audio and video telecommunications system that permits real-time communication between the beneficiary at the originating sites (patient sites) and the provider at the distant site (physician or other qualified health care professional) 1.
  • The telehealth modifier cannot be used with the asynchronous (store and forward) technology 1.
  • The code is part of a series of psychotherapy codes that vary based on session duration, and 90832 is specifically mentioned as one of the codes of interest to psychiatrists that can be used with the telemedicine modifier ("95") 1. When using this code, the provider should document the start and end times of the session, therapeutic techniques used, the patient's response to treatment, and any plans for future sessions.

CPT Code 90832 Description

  • CPT code 90832 refers to a 30-minute psychotherapy session with a physician or other qualified healthcare professional [ 2, 3, 4, 5, 6 ].
  • This code is used to bill for individual psychotherapy sessions, which may include cognitive-behavioral therapy, psychodynamic psychotherapy, or other forms of talk therapy.
  • The session may be conducted in an office or outpatient setting and may involve the use of various therapeutic techniques, such as exposure, cognitive therapy, or supportive psychotherapy.
